>> It seems that culprit in this case is tc_action->order field. It is used
>> as nla attrtype when dumping actions. Initially it is set according to
>> ordering of actions of filter that creates them. However, it is
>> overwritten in tca_action_gd() each time action is dumped through action
>> API (according to action position in tb array) and when new filter is
>> attached to shared action (according to action order on the filter).
>> With this we have another way to reproduce the bug:
>>
>> sudo tc qdisc add dev lo ingress
>>
>> #shared action is the first action (order 1)
>> sudo tc filter add dev lo parent ffff: protocol ip prio 8 u32 \
>> match ip dst 127.0.0.8/32 flowid 1:10 \
>> action drop index 104 \
>> action vlan push id 100 protocol 802.1q
>>
>> #shared action is the the second action (order 2)
>> sudo tc filter add dev lo parent ffff: protocol ip prio 8 u32 \
>> match ip dst 127.0.0.10/32 flowid 1:10 \
>> action vlan push id 101 protocol 802.1q \
>> action drop index 104
>>
>> # Now action is only visible on one filter
>> sudo tc -s filter ls dev lo parent ffff: protocol ip
